3.17 Synchronized actions
3.17.1 Definition of a synchronized action
A synchronous action is defined in a block of a part program. Any further commands that are
not part of the synchronous action, may not be programmed within this block.
A synchronous action consists of the following components:
Validity, ID
no.
(optional)
Condition part
(optional)
Action part with condition fulfilled Action part with condition unfulfil‐
led
(optional)
Frequency G com‐
mand
(option‐
al)
Condition Keyword G com‐
mand
(option‐
al)
Actions Keyword G com‐
mand
(option‐
al)
Actions
---
1)
ID=<no.>
IDS=<no.
>
---
1)
WHENEVER
FROM
WHEN
EVERY
G... Logical
Expressio
n
DO G... Action 1
...
Action n
ELSE G... Action 1
...
Action n
1)
Not programmed
Syntax
DO <action 1> ... <action n>
<frequency> [<G function>] <condition> DO <action 1> ... <action n>
ID=<No> <frequency> [<G function>] <condition> DO <action 1> ...
<action n>
IDS=<No> <frequency> [<G function>] <condition> DO <action 1> ...
<action n>
IDS=<no.> <frequency> [<G function>] <condition> DO <action 1...n>
ELSE <action 1...n>
Further information
Function Manual Synchronous Actions
Work preparation
3.17 Synchronized actions
NC programming
950 Programming Manual, 12/2019, 6FC5398-2EP40-0BA0